    Facial liposuction in Edmonton is a popular procedure for those seeking to enhance their facial contours and reduce excess fat in areas such as the cheeks, chin, and neck. The cost of facial liposuction can vary significantly depending on several factors, including the extent of the procedure, the expertise of the surgeon, and the specific techniques used.

    On average, the price for facial liposuction in Edmonton ranges from $2,500 to $5,000. This cost typically includes the surgeon's fee, facility fees, anesthesia, and any post-operative care. It's important to note that while cost is a consideration, choosing a qualified and experienced surgeon is crucial for achieving optimal results and ensuring safety.

    Factors that can influence the cost include: - Surgeon's Experience: Highly skilled surgeons often charge more due to their expertise and successful track record. - Extent of Fat Removal: More extensive procedures may require additional time and resources, affecting the overall cost. - Anesthesia: The type of anesthesia used can also impact the price. General anesthesia is typically more expensive than local anesthesia. - Facility Fees: The location and reputation of the clinic or hospital can also affect the cost.

    Before making a decision, it's advisable to schedule consultations with several surgeons to discuss your goals, expectations, and budget. This will help you make an informed choice and ensure you receive the best possible care.

    What to Expect During the Procedure

    Facial liposuction is typically performed under local anesthesia with sedation or general anesthesia, depending on the extent of the procedure. The surgeon will make small incisions in the targeted areas and use a thin tube called a cannula to suction out the excess fat. The procedure usually takes about 1 to 2 hours to complete.

    Recovery and Results

    Recovery from facial liposuction generally involves some swelling, bruising, and discomfort, which can be managed with prescribed medications. Most patients can return to their normal activities within a week, though complete recovery may take several weeks. The final results of the procedure will become more apparent as the swelling subsides, typically within a few months.

    Factors Influencing the Cost

    Several elements contribute to the overall cost of facial liposuction. Firstly, the complexity of the procedure plays a significant role. More extensive fat removal or additional procedures such as skin tightening can increase the cost. Secondly, the experience and reputation of the surgeon are crucial. Highly skilled surgeons often charge more due to their expertise and the superior results they deliver. Lastly, the techniques employed, whether traditional liposuction or more advanced methods like laser-assisted liposuction, can also affect the price.

    Average Cost Range

    In Edmonton, the cost of facial liposuction typically ranges from $2,500 to $5,000. This range provides a general idea, but individual costs can vary. For instance, a minor procedure focusing on a small area might fall on the lower end of this spectrum, while a more comprehensive treatment involving multiple areas or additional techniques could approach the higher end.
